WebFeb 24, 2024 · Conscience [ kon -sh uh ns ] is a noun that refers to a person’s inner sense of right and wrong. Conscious [ kon -sh uh s ] is an adjective meaning aware or, more literally, awake—as in the opposite of unconscious. Like many other adjectives, conscious ends in -ous. Webconscience, a personal sense of the moral content of one’s own conduct, intentions, or character with regard to a feeling of obligation to do right or be good. Conscience, usually informed by acculturation and instruction, is thus generally understood to give intuitively authoritative judgments regarding the moral quality of single actions. WebPhilosopher James Childress has described appeals to conscience as "a person's consciousness of and reflection on his own acts in relation to his standards of judgment." (Childress, 1979) Rights of conscience are political rights that protect people's ability to do what they believe is morally best: they are political autonomy rights. WebConscience [N] [T] [E] Conscience is a term that describes an aspect of a human being's self-awareness. It is part of a person's internal rational capacity and is not, as popular lore sometimes suggests, an audience room for the voice of God or of the devil.
